YAZILIM TEKNİK ŞARTNAMESİ
1. GİRİŞ
1.1. Amaç
Bu teknik şartname, [Kurum/Firma Adı]’nın [Proje Adı] yazılım projesi kapsamında geliştirilecek yazılımın teknik özelliklerini, performans kriterlerini, güvenlik gereksinimlerini ve diğer hususları belirlemek amacıyla hazırlanmıştır.
1.2. Kapsam
Bu şartname, aşağıdaki yazılım bileşenlerini kapsar:
-
[Yazılımın Adı]
-
[Yazılımın Türü] (Örneğin: Web uygulaması, mobil uygulama, masaüstü uygulaması)
-
[Yazılımın Kullanım Amacı] (Örneğin: Stok takibi, müşteri ilişkileri yönetimi, e-ticaret vb.)
1.3. Taraflar
-
İşveren: [Kurum/Firma Adı]
-
Yüklenici: [Yazılım Geliştirme Firması Adı]
2. TEKNİK ÖZELLİKLER
2.1. Genel Özellikler
-
Programlama Dili: [Programlama Dili] (Örneğin: Java, Python, C#, PHP vb.)
-
Veritabanı: [Veritabanı Yönetim Sistemi] (Örneğin: MySQL, PostgreSQL, Oracle vb.)
-
Geliştirme Ortamı: [Geliştirme Ortamı] (Örneğin: Eclipse, Visual Studio, IntelliJ IDEA vb.)
-
Platform: [Platform] (Örneğin: Web, iOS, Android, Windows, macOS vb.)
-
Lisanslama: [Lisans Türü] (Örneğin: Açık kaynak, ticari lisans vb.)
2.2. Fonksiyonel Gereksinimler
-
Kullanıcı Yönetimi: Kullanıcı kaydı, giriş, yetkilendirme, profil yönetimi vb.
-
İçerik Yönetimi: İçerik ekleme, düzenleme, silme, yayınlama vb.
-
Raporlama: Farklı kriterlere göre rapor oluşturma ve dışa aktarma
-
Arama: İçerikler arasında arama yapabilme
-
(Proje özelinde diğer fonksiyonel gereksinimler)
2.3. Performans Kriterleri
-
Yanıt Süresi: [Maksimum Yanıt Süresi] saniye (Örneğin: 2 saniye)
-
Eş Zamanlı Kullanıcı Sayısı: [Maksimum Eş Zamanlı Kullanıcı Sayısı]
-
Yük Testi: [Yük Testi Detayları]
-
Güvenlik Testi: [Güvenlik Testi Detayları]
2.4. Güvenlik Gereksinimleri
-
Veri Güvenliği: Veri şifreleme, yetkisiz erişim koruması, yedekleme vb.
-
Kullanıcı Kimlik Doğrulama: Güçlü parola politikası, iki faktörlü kimlik doğrulama vb.
-
Güvenlik Duvarı: Web uygulaması saldırılarına karşı koruma
-
(Proje özelinde diğer güvenlik gereksinimleri)
3. TASARIM
-
Kullanıcı Arayüzü (UI): Kullanıcı dostu, kolay kullanılabilir ve estetik bir arayüz tasarımı.
-
Kullanıcı Deneyimi (UX): Kullanıcıların yazılımı kolaylıkla kullanabilmesi için optimize edilmiş bir deneyim.
-
Renk Paleti ve Tipografi: İşverenin kurumsal kimliğine uygun renkler ve fontlar kullanılacaktır.
4. TEST VE KABUL
-
Test Aşamaları: Birim testi, entegrasyon testi, sistem testi, kabul testi
-
Kabul Kriterleri: İşverenin onayı ile belirlenecek kabul kriterlerine uygunluk
5. TESLİMAT VE EĞİTİM
-
Teslimat: Yazılımın kaynak kodları, dokümantasyonu ve kurulum dosyaları işverene teslim edilecektir.
-
Eğitim: Yüklenici, işverenin personelini yazılımın kullanımı konusunda eğitecektir.
6. GARANTİ VE DESTEK
-
Garanti Süresi: [Garanti Süresi] yıl
-
Teknik Destek: Yüklenici, garanti süresi boyunca teknik destek sağlayacaktır.
7. DİĞER HUSUSLAR
-
Fikri Mülkiyet Hakları: Yazılımın fikri mülkiyet hakları, işverene ait olacaktır.
-
Gizlilik: Yüklenici, proje kapsamında edindiği bilgileri gizli tutacaktır.
-
Anlaşmazlıkların Çözümü: Taraflar arasında çıkabilecek anlaşmazlıklar, öncelikle iyi niyetle çözümlenmeye çalışılır. Çözülemeyen anlaşmazlıklar için [Mahkeme/Tahkim] yoluna gidilir.
İşveren:
[Kurum/Firma Adı] [İmza ve Kaşe]
Yüklenici:
[Yazılım Geliştirme Firması Adı] [İmza ve Kaşe]
Tarih: [Tarih]
Aşağıdaki ilgili butona tıklayarak belgeyi dosya olarak indirebilirsiniz.
Diğer yazı örneklerini görmek için aşağıdaki butonlara tıklayarak ilgili kategoriye gidebilirsiniz.